Default Qualifications required to becoming a Meat Hygiene Inspector

A meat Hygiene inspector needs Level 3 Certificate in Meat Hygiene and Inspection of Level 3 Certificate in Meat Hygiene and Inspection. For this certification you should posses five GCSEs including Maths, English and science. Associate membership of the meat training Council or experience of working in meat industry is needed. Course completion requires practical work placements. Once you start the career you will learn training form experienced hands. A meat Hygiene inspector must have knowledge in anatomy, physiology, pathology, animal welfare, food hygiene laws and meat inspection. Practical training in slaughterhouses and factories are also helpful.
